Byline: Robert Denerstein Rocky Mountain News Film Critic
The World of Apu
Grade A
Apu, Soumitra Chatterjee; Aparna, Sarmila Tagore; Pulu, Swapan Mukherjee; Kajal, Alok Chakravarti; Sasinaryan, Dhiresh Majumdar. Based on the novel by Bibhutibhusan Banerjee. Written and directed by Satyajit Ray. Bengali with English subtitles. Unrated: For one week at the Chez Artiste, as part of the Satyajit Ray series.
Who's it for? Art film lovers.
